Plugin Actions

Introduction

Actions are events (or hooks) to which callback functions can be attached.

In the example below, the event is report_add, and the email_subscribers callback is attached to this particular event. Whenever this event is encountered, all the associated plugins that are attached to this event will be executed.

Example:

<?php
// Email subscribers whenever a new report is created
Event::add('ushahidi_action.report_add', 'email_subscribers');
?>
